5v5 to 8v8 with Neutral Players

  • Organisation

    • 4 cones to mark the field
    • Divide into a 5v5 game (or more, up to 8v8) with 4 neutral players

  • Process

    Play in a 5v5 (or more, up to 8v8) game with 4 neutral players focusing on ball retention. The goal is to move the ball between the neutral players on the opposite ends of the field. The neutral players always play with the team in possession of the ball.

  • Tip

    Coaching Points

    • Expand the playing field
    • Offer support in an open position
    • Move into depth to get out of the defensive shadow
    • Neutral players should adjust their positions to avoid being in the defensive shadow of opposing players
    • Look for open spaces to receive the ball
    • Always create at least 3 passing options - left, right, central

  • Field size

    32m x 16m
